ABSTRACT Inflammatory syndromes, including those caused by infection, are a major cause of hospital admissions among children and often misdiagnosed because lack advanced molecular diagnostic tools. In this study, we explored the utility circulating cell-free RNA (cfRNA) in plasma as an analyte for differential diagnosis characterization pediatric inflammatory syndromes. We profiled cfRNA 370 samples from patients with range conditions, Kawasaki disease (KD), Multisystem Syndrome Children (MIS-C), viral infections bacterial infections. developed machine learning models based on these profiles, which effectively differentiated KD MIS-C — two conditions presenting overlapping symptoms high performance (Test Area Under Curve (AUC) = 0.97). further extended methodology into multiclass framework that achieved 81% accuracy distinguishing KD, MIS-C, viral, demonstrated profiles can be used to quantify injury specific tissues organs, liver, heart, endothelium, nervous system, upper respiratory tract.
